Endothelial Lipase Assay: To assay for cell surface lipase activity, cells expressing human endothelial lipase (EL) or LPL were plated in CellBIND® 384-well plates (Corning, Lowell, Mass.) in 25 μL serum free medium at a density of 2000 cells/well. After 18-24 hours incubation at 37° C., the medium was removed and replaced with 15 μL assay buffer [Hank's Buffered Saline Solution with 25 mM HEPES pH 7.2] and 15 μL PLA1 substrate for a final concentration of 10 μM using a Multidrop reagent dispenser. Fluorescence signal was monitored for 30 min at 37° C. on a Safire II plate reader in kinetic mode (60 cycles, kinetic interval: 30 seconds) with an excitation wavelength of 490 nm and an emission wavelength of 515 nm.
